How often do babies change their diapers?

by:V-Care     2021-10-23

The baby cried suddenly, and novice parents are often at a loss. In fact, many times it is because the baby's diapers are too heavy or the baby has a bowel movement. Novice parents should learn to change their baby's diapers at this time so that they can reduce the discomfort caused by the uncomfortable ass. How often do babies change their diapers?

Do not use baby diapers for 24 hours.

Allow your baby's butt to dry in the air regularly to bask in the sun. If parents have time, they can use diapers several times during the day. Baby diapers and diapers are used alternately, which is economical and can prevent the baby from being in the diaper package for a long time. Baby diapers should be used at night or when taking the baby out, and cotton diapers can be used at other times. This not only increases the time the baby’s buttocks are exposed to air but also conforms to the actual consumption capacity of the public.

The joints should adhere firmly: when changing diapers for babies, the joints should adhere firmly. Do not let baby care products such as oil, powder, or shower gel get onto the joints to avoid lower adhesion. Change baby diapers frequently during the initial period of use, regardless of whether the child urinates or not, change it every 2-3 hours.

As the child continues to grow, the number of changing baby diapers will gradually decrease, starting with an average of ten times a day, and gradually reducing to six times. If the baby has urine and urine on the diaper, it should be replaced immediately, and the baby’s buttocks should be washed with warm water and cotton gauze. Never use wet wipes to wipe the thing casually; after washing, be sure to wait for the little butt to dry completely before replacing it with a new one. Diapers. If there is some redness on the baby's buttocks, mothers don't panic. You can apply some ointment to get rid of it in a short time.

Over-aged use has endless suffering. Generally speaking, the time when the baby stops using diapers should be before the child is 2 years old. If you have been using baby diapers and diapers, the habit becomes natural, which can easily lead to habitual or lazy bedwetting.

In addition, the time to stop using baby diapers is summer, because in winter, if you suddenly stop using it, your child will lie wet after wetting the bed, and it is easy to catch a cold. Especially after being able to walk, it will affect their walking posture.
